Splitting auditing and consulting: EY auditors fear a pay cut

Large 4 companies are going back to the long run. In 2002, Deloitte grew to become the very last Massive 4 agency (who were at that time the Significant 5) to split its accounting and consulting arms following Enron scandal. Considering that then, accounting and consulting have rekindled their romance and most of the Large Four are as embroiled as they ever had been. Yesterday, though, the Economic Times documented that EY – the smallest of the large amount – has been operating on dividing the auditing and consulting divisions yet again. It really is not likely to be the only one particular: the United kingdom Money Reporting Council (FRC) has requested the Huge 4 to put their British isles auditing and consulting tactics in independent small business models by 2024. 

We spoke to multiple men and women at EY. In auditing, few appear completely in favour of the shift. 

For auditors, spinning out consulting suggests the elimination of a significant and beneficial high margin business enterprise that helped subsidize pay back, especially at the major end. “Consulting is wherever the money is, and the revenue made there is only raising,” claimed one EY auditor, noting that audit associates will be on their own in the potential.  

Several auditors also aspire to go out of audit and into careers in the more rewarding consulting arms. When this has by no means been quick, it will be pretty much not possible when the two are independent entities. If other users of the Large 4 never promptly separate the two companies also, there’s a threat that EY’s audit organization will be much less attractive to everyone who sees auditing as a stepping-stone to a consulting occupation.

Other members of EY’s audit group expressed dismay that the shift will compress their margins. “I’m against this,” claimed one associate. “Auditors call for the guidance of professionals, these kinds of as the tax/valuations group. Even right after separation, we would require to make the most of the providers of other departments, which is illogical. I value we can allocate some professionals completely for audit, nevertheless I do not see this as a solution.” 

Although auditors are dismayed at the prospect of getting rid of close ties with consultants, consultants are less bothered about dropping the proximity of auditors. Present limits signify companies are unable to offer consulting advice to a mentioned enterprise within a year of an audit. Immediately after the separation, consultants will be absolutely free to solicit any customer they want. “We will shed business enterprise introductions across the assistance traces, but auditing is frequently restrictive for the company finance and consulting procedures,” claims one KPMG company financier. “It will be fascinating to see how the EY branding is retained or break up if the separation does come about,” he adds.  

Not all EY auditors are apprehensive about the transfer. Just one welcomed the option to shut down questions about audit integrity. He also denied that auditing is a essentially less appealing purpose: “We’re moving to far more analytically-driven digital audits,” he says. “- I individually have no intention of becoming a advisor rather.”
